Wrong Turn 3 acts as a direct continuation of the, at the time, small universe established in Wrong Turn 2: Dead End (2007). It continues to establish Three Finger as the primary, enduring threat of the West Virginia woods, setting the stage for further sequels and the eventual 2021 reboot. Why Watch?

While Wrong Turn 3 prioritizing visceral thrills over deep philosophical subtext, it does explore the corrupting nature of greed. The introduction of the armored car's cash bags serves as a psychological trap that proves just as lethal as Three Finger’s physical snares. index of wrong turn 3

As the first entry in the franchise released directly to DVD and Blu-ray, it marked a shift in budgetary scale, visual style, and narrative ambition.
